Result: Ayr, Carrick & Cumnock
| TOP THREE PARTIES AT A GLANCE | ||
|---|---|---|
| Labour | 45.4% | |
| Conservative | 23.2% | |
| Liberal Democrat | 14.1% | |
| Swing: 2.2% from LAB to CON | ||
| IN DETAIL | ||||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Name | Party | Votes | % | +/- % |
| Sandra Osborne | Labour | 20,433 | 45.4 | -5.9 |
| Mark Jones | Conservative | 10,436 | 23.2 | -1.6 |
| Colin Waugh | Liberal Democrat | 6,341 | 14.1 | +6.9 |
| Chic Brodie | SNP | 5,932 | 13.2 | -0.5 |
| Donald Sharp | Scottish Senior Citizens Unity Party | 592 | 1.3 | +1.3 |
| Murray Steele | Scottish Socialist Party | 554 | 1.2 | -1.2 |
| Jim McDaid | Socialist Labour Party | 395 | 0.9 | +0.3 |
| Bryan McCormack | UK Independence Party | 365 | 0.8 | +0.7 |
| Majority | 9,997 | 22.2 | ||
| Turnout | 45,048 | 61.3 | -1.6 | |
